CSB briefed on UAE government excellence system
A delegation from the Office of the Prime Minister of the United Arab Emirates, represented by Dr. Yasser Al Naqbi, Assistant Director General for the Sector of Government Leaders and Capacities, and Manal Bin Salem from the Government Leadership and Capacities Sector, attended a meeting chaired by the Civil Service Bureau’s President.
The Emirati delegation presented UAE’s vision 2021, the experience of the Mohammed bin Rashid Centre for Government Innovation, and the system of government excellence, all of which enable government agencies to achieve prosperity and happiness for citizens, and meet requirements and expectations of the community to obtain seven-star government quality services with high efficiency and effectiveness, as well as supporting the government’s innovation trends, which brings Dubai and the UAE a competitive advantage and a leading position.
The UAE Government Excellence Programme is a roadmap for governments seeking to reach new heights beyond excellence to achieve the level of leadership in performance and transformation into a proactive, innovative and smart government that will serve as an example for government’s best practices through a set of principles, including efficiency, learning and development. Furthermore, using tools such as modern concepts in government work including innovation, foresight and integration in government work, development of government services in a single platform, intelligent handling of these services, and the National Customer Relationship Management System, will help in achieving that goal.
The meeting, attended by directors-general, directors and other CSB officials, shed light on the UAE government’s E-Performance management system, Management of strategic plans and UAE Government Leaders Programme. The focus was on the experience of government accelerators aimed at speeding up the government’s strategic projects by rethinking how the government works and providing a model and work mechanisms that ensure rapid results in an innovative way.
